2. Information Gain: Why Refining Matters (vCB vs. rCB)

Standard pyrolysis char often contains high ash content and volatiles, making it unsuitable for high-end rubber applications. Our Recovered Carbon Black Refining Plants offer significant information gain by implementing a multi-stage upgrading process:

  • Jet Milling & Micronization: Reducing particle size to the D90 < 20μm range to match N550/N660 virgin grades.
  • De-ashing Technology: Chemical or mechanical removal of inorganic residues to improve tensile strength in finished rubber products.
  • Pelletizing & Drying: Ensuring consistent bulk density and low dust for automated manufacturing lines in Slovenia’s smart factories.

3. Global Procurement Trends: From Waste to High-Value Filler

Global procurement specialists are shifting away from "simple pyrolysis." The trend is moving toward integrated refineries that can guarantee consistent PH levels and DBP absorption values. Can your systems process different types of waste tire sizes common in Slovenia?

Yes, we offer systems ranging from semi-continuous rotary kilns (handling whole tires or large blocks) to fully continuous screw systems (optimized for rubber powder or 5-10cm tire blocks).
